Skip to main content

Boolean operations on paths using the Skia library

Project description

Travis CI Status Appveyor CI Status PyPI

Python bindings for the Google Skia library's Path Ops module, performing boolean operations on paths (intersection, union, difference, xor).

Build

A recent version of Cython is required to build the package (see the pyproject.toml file for the minimum required version).

For developers we recommend installing in editable mode using pip install -e ., and compiling the extension module in the same source directory.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

skia_pathops-0.2.0.post1-cp37-cp37m-win_amd64.whl (310.0 kB view details)

Uploaded CPython 3.7m Windows x86-64

skia_pathops-0.2.0.post1-cp37-cp37m-win32.whl (250.3 kB view details)

Uploaded CPython 3.7m Windows x86

skia_pathops-0.2.0.post1-cp36-cp36m-win_amd64.whl (310.0 kB view details)

Uploaded CPython 3.6m Windows x86-64

skia_pathops-0.2.0.post1-cp36-cp36m-win32.whl (250.5 kB view details)

Uploaded CPython 3.6m Windows x86

skia_pathops-0.2.0.post1-cp27-cp27m-win_amd64.whl (463.8 kB view details)

Uploaded CPython 2.7m Windows x86-64

skia_pathops-0.2.0.post1-cp27-cp27m-win32.whl (420.7 kB view details)

Uploaded CPython 2.7m Windows x86

File details

Details for the file skia_pathops-0.2.0.post1-cp37-cp37m-win_amd64.whl.

File metadata

  • Download URL: skia_pathops-0.2.0.post1-cp37-cp37m-win_amd64.whl
  • Upload date:
  • Size: 310.0 kB
  • Tags: CPython 3.7m,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.1.0 requests-toolbelt/0.8.0 tqdm/4.24.0 CPython/3.7.0

File hashes

Hashes for skia_pathops-0.2.0.post1-cp37-cp37m-win_amd64.whl
Algorithm Hash digest
SHA256 65c0c884358bf74eab34c3338783d86b71ec44addc555697bb3ae50184e9dfaf
MD5 4c48adafd35f1654c058d1dd5ca627d3
BLAKE2b-256 2b314bf4739cdae86a46120976116acf7776133d34e6e88e9893330932db8c5f

See more details on using hashes here.

Provenance

File details

Details for the file skia_pathops-0.2.0.post1-cp37-cp37m-win32.whl.

File metadata

  • Download URL: skia_pathops-0.2.0.post1-cp37-cp37m-win32.whl
  • Upload date:
  • Size: 250.3 kB
  • Tags: CPython 3.7m,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.1.0 requests-toolbelt/0.8.0 tqdm/4.24.0 CPython/3.7.0

File hashes

Hashes for skia_pathops-0.2.0.post1-cp37-cp37m-win32.whl
Algorithm Hash digest
SHA256 c55f3377c8caa8deac833f1a6dd9b659f82e89441e10f0d6ffb80729d05dae81
MD5 791703348f08006422fd44590d516290
BLAKE2b-256 4d57cd5819023ccafa311f4aaa93e66c10eb941093d1f0e9567a5184d7452561

See more details on using hashes here.

Provenance

File details

Details for the file skia_pathops-0.2.0.post1-cp36-cp36m-win_amd64.whl.

File metadata

  • Download URL: skia_pathops-0.2.0.post1-cp36-cp36m-win_amd64.whl
  • Upload date:
  • Size: 310.0 kB
  • Tags: CPython 3.6m,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.1.0 requests-toolbelt/0.8.0 tqdm/4.24.0 CPython/3.6.6

File hashes

Hashes for skia_pathops-0.2.0.post1-cp36-cp36m-win_amd64.whl
Algorithm Hash digest
SHA256 5416353e105d363fa4a146e5a3b4f774a442eb026a38fc89e1d123a03eac5760
MD5 d3b9990e2559c5489266be9861902ab5
BLAKE2b-256 7672bbccd0fe06b18384394daaf01cac7dd7ed529a67ac343beb147f11dc400c

See more details on using hashes here.

Provenance

File details

Details for the file skia_pathops-0.2.0.post1-cp36-cp36m-win32.whl.

File metadata

  • Download URL: skia_pathops-0.2.0.post1-cp36-cp36m-win32.whl
  • Upload date:
  • Size: 250.5 kB
  • Tags: CPython 3.6m,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.1.0 requests-toolbelt/0.8.0 tqdm/4.24.0 CPython/3.6.6

File hashes

Hashes for skia_pathops-0.2.0.post1-cp36-cp36m-win32.whl
Algorithm Hash digest
SHA256 48af2a9219e795b96a9bfb0e93a7b41fee3fa2fd7bd759490a27a16ae6d87f39
MD5 ab24dc0bf85586f45e2418fded302599
BLAKE2b-256 7df4f943166b8db459f0eb842900e683d4fd6f6206b1b2905bd9734c95fbe54e

See more details on using hashes here.

Provenance

File details

Details for the file skia_pathops-0.2.0.post1-cp27-cp27m-win_amd64.whl.

File metadata

  • Download URL: skia_pathops-0.2.0.post1-cp27-cp27m-win_amd64.whl
  • Upload date:
  • Size: 463.8 kB
  • Tags: CPython 2.7m, Windows x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.1.0 requests-toolbelt/0.8.0 tqdm/4.24.0 CPython/2.7.15

File hashes

Hashes for skia_pathops-0.2.0.post1-cp27-cp27m-win_amd64.whl
Algorithm Hash digest
SHA256 3207e5b551353e8847708cebecb654994c51a12b4304468ec1f784b0fdf5ab40
MD5 beb7eaf827e5115b473cbe34bff97f7d
BLAKE2b-256 39157830a7d6b2e8ec74b55ac8af32578e93fabb403ef2e25db494150f8d2985

See more details on using hashes here.

Provenance

File details

Details for the file skia_pathops-0.2.0.post1-cp27-cp27m-win32.whl.

File metadata

  • Download URL: skia_pathops-0.2.0.post1-cp27-cp27m-win32.whl
  • Upload date:
  • Size: 420.7 kB
  • Tags: CPython 2.7m, Windows x86
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.11.0 pkginfo/1.4.2 requests/2.19.1 setuptools/40.1.0 requests-toolbelt/0.8.0 tqdm/4.24.0 CPython/2.7.15

File hashes

Hashes for skia_pathops-0.2.0.post1-cp27-cp27m-win32.whl
Algorithm Hash digest
SHA256 ccfc4f2524a2d42795c6d50c11fddd4415329889b07f1eee78fff048a93b5ffd
MD5 059aae9ccb6743d3faa8c51502b1c823
BLAKE2b-256 d9f8048e2c289005c2f91fea36e181969ca33f2ad0afbbc37c62f8badf6fc716

See more details on using hashes here.

Provenance

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page